2011 Provincial Jiu Jitsu Championship

The Ontario Jiu Jitsu Association is happy to announce that the 2011 Provincial Jiu Jitsu Championship will be held on the weekend of November 26th and 27th, 2011 in Toronto. This is the 3rd Annual Tournament event, taking place at Pope John Paul II High School. The event has grown since its inception in 2009;  last year’s event catered to 500+ competitors over two days. This year’s event will draw competitors from all over Ontario.  Many clubs from the GTA as well as Ottawa, Kingston, Oshawa, Barrie, Sudbury, North Bay, London, Hamilton, Welland, Niagara Falls, Georgetown, Burlington, Guelph, Kitchener will participate in this annual Championship. Divisions for Adult, Master, Juvenile, and Children/Teens (5-15 years).  There will be divisions for all belt ranks, for both male and female. New medal design for 2011 Champions and finalists, Team Awards for 1st,2nd & 3rd .  place overall and Absolute divisions for Blue Belts and up.

Select Point Leaders (top medalists) in adult White & Blue Belt divisions from this year’s OJA-sanctioned events will have their entry fee waived for the Provincial Championship. In addition to the Brazilian Jiu Jitsu divisions, Sunday will also feature a Sport Jiu Jitsu Division for both Kids and Adults.
